About Umngazi River

On the Eastern Cape's Wild Coast, a superb beach begins at the Umngazi River mouth and stretches along the rugged coast to Brazen Head, known for its pounding surf. This coastal region is home to roughly 130 species of birds.

FAMILY RESORT - UMNGAZI MOUTH
"Tucked away on the Wild Coast, in the heart of Pondoland, and encompassed by a rocky coastline, indigenous forests, secluded coves and breathtaking views of the Indian Ocean, lies Umngazi River Bungalows & Spa – an award-winning family resort and spa. The thatch-roofed bungalows are situated amongst the indigenous gardens, which provide the perfect setting for a totally relaxed holiday. Weekly fly-in packages are available Friday to Friday from Durban where you fly at 500 feet above sea level along the beautiful coastline – a wonderful way to start your holiday. Spend idyllic days on secluded beaches, hiking, biking, canoeing, fishing and more."
